Abstract: ABSTRACT Background Diabetes mellitus is an alarming metabolic disorder, posing a global public health concern due to its association with high blood sugar levels. Vildagliptin, a DPP-4 inhibitor, is an antidiabetic agent used for the management of type 2 diabetes mellitus. The present research explores the formulation and optimization of two types of Vildagliptin-based nanoparticle systems—Vildagliptin-Eudragit RL 100 coated nanoparticles (VLD Eud NPs) and Chitosan- Vildagliptin nanoparticles (CS VLD NPs)—for sustained drug delivery using a QbD approach. Objectives In the present study, an attempt was made to formulate and optimize oral polymeric-coated Vildagliptin nanoformulations using the QbD approach and to evaluate their in vivo antidiabetic activity in Streptozotocin-induced diabetic Wistar rats.
